A050118 a(n) = n-th number of the form L(i)*L(j), i<=j, when these products of Lucas numbers are arranged in order. +0
2
1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 7, 8, 9, 11, 12, 14, 16, 18, 21, 22, 28, 29, 33, 36, 44, 47, 49, 54, 58, 72, 76, 77, 87, 94, 116, 121, 123, 126, 141, 152, 188, 198, 199, 203, 228, 246, 304, 319, 322, 324, 329, 369, 398, 492, 517, 521, 522, 532, 597 (list; graph; listen)
